Home Environment Clicking Noises

In the home environment, clicking noises can be particularly bothersome, especially at night when the house is quiest. These noises can be due to settling foundation, expanding and contracting pipes, or issues with the heating and cooling systems. For example, a clicking sound coming from the walls or floor might indicate that the house is settling, which is a common occurrence, especially in new constructions. However, if the noise is persistent and accompanies other signs like cracks in the walls, it might indicate a more serious issue that requires professional attention.

Technical Approaches to Identifying the Source

In some cases, especially with electronic devices or vehicles, a more technical approach may be necessary. This could involve:

Device/Vehicle Possible Causes Investigation Methods
Computer Hard drive failure, motherboard issues Run diagnostic tests, check for dust buildup
Vehicle Loose belts, low fluid levels, electrical system malfunctions Consult the vehicle’s manual, use a multimeter for electrical tests

Solutions and Remedies

Once the source of the clicking noise is identified, the next step is to find a solution. This can range from simple adjustments or repairs to more complex fixes that might require professional help. For example, if the clicking noise in your home is due to expanding and contracting pipes, you might be able to mitigate the noise by insulating the pipes or using pipe noise-reducing products. In vehicles, a clicking noise could be due to a loose serpentine belt, which can be easily tightened.

What are some common causes of the weird clicking noise in homes?

In homes, the weird clicking noise can be caused by a variety of factors, including mechanical devices, electrical systems, and structural issues. Some common causes of the noise include faulty thermostats, loose pipes, and malfunctioning appliances, such as refrigerators, air conditioners, or washing machines. Additionally, the noise can also be caused by external factors, such as construction work, traffic, or weather-related events, which can produce vibrations or sounds that are transmitted through the building.

Other common causes of the weird clicking noise in homes include pest infestations, such as rodents or insects, which can produce sounds as they move through walls or ceilings. In some cases, the noise can also be caused by human activity, such as foot traffic, door openings, or other everyday events. To resolve the issue, it is essential to investigate these potential causes and take steps to eliminate or mitigate them. This can involve repairing or replacing faulty devices, sealing entry points, or using soundproofing materials to reduce the transmission of noise.
